JSP+ACCESS留言板



**JSP+ACCESS留言板系统详解** 本教程将详细介绍一个基于JSP(JavaServer Pages)和ACCESS数据库构建的简单留言板网站。这个系统对于初学者来说是一个很好的起点,它可以帮助你理解和掌握JSP的基本语法以及如何与数据库进行交互。下面我们将深入探讨这个系统的组成部分和实现原理。 **1. JSP技术介绍** JSP是Java的一种动态网页技术,允许开发者在HTML代码中嵌入Java代码,以实现服务器端的动态网页生成。JSP文件会被Web容器(如Tomcat)转换为Servlet,然后执行生成HTML响应。 **2. ACCESS数据库** ACCESS是微软公司开发的一个小型关系型数据库管理系统,适用于个人或小团队的项目。在这个留言板系统中,ACCESS用于存储用户留下的信息,包括用户名、留言内容和时间等。 **3. 系统架构** 这个留言板系统主要由以下几个部分组成: - 用户界面:用户可以通过浏览器查看已有的留言,并提交新的留言。 - 服务器端逻辑:JSP页面处理用户的请求,如获取表单数据,与数据库交互。 - 数据库交互:JSP通过SQL语句与ACCESS数据库进行通信,实现数据的读写操作。 - 管理员功能:管理员可以进行留言管理,包括回复、删除等操作。 **4. JSP页面** - `index.jsp`:主页面,显示留言列表和留言表单。 - `submit.jsp`:处理用户提交的留言,将数据保存到数据库。 - `manage.jsp`:管理员登录页面。 - `admin.jsp`:管理员管理页面,展示可管理的留言并提供操作选项。 **5. 数据库设计** 通常,留言板系统会有一个名为`message`的表,包含以下字段: - `id`:主键,唯一标识每条留言。 - `username`:留言者用户名。 - `content`:留言内容。 - `time`:留言时间。 **6. SQL操作** JSP页面中的Java代码会执行SQL语句,例如: - 插入新留言:`INSERT INTO message (username, content, time) VALUES (?, ?, ?)` - 查询所有留言:`SELECT * FROM message` - 删除留言:`DELETE FROM message WHERE id=?` - 更新留言:`UPDATE message SET content=? WHERE id=?` **7. 安全性考虑** 虽然这个系统适合初学者练习,但实际部署时要注意安全性问题,如SQL注入防护、用户输入验证等。 **8. 总结** 通过学习和实践这个JSP+ACCESS留言板系统,你可以了解Web应用的基本结构,掌握JSP与数据库的交互,以及简单的后台管理功能实现。随着技能的提升,你可以尝试使用更强大的数据库(如MySQL)、框架(如Spring Boot)来构建更复杂、安全的应用。

































- 1

- 粉丝: 2
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


最新资源
- 学籍管理系统数据库课程设计.doc
- 基于CDIO理念的卓越软件人才培养的研究获奖科研报告论文.docx
- 节点负载度均衡控制算法研究.ppt
- 工程项目管理质量控制基本方法.docx
- 智慧邮政信息化产品推荐.讲义.ppt
- 上海电信前端渠道会策划案PPT课件.ppt
- 关于印发《山东省自然科学基金项目管理办法》等七个文件的通知.pdf
- 关于大学生计算机专业实习心得体会精选范文.docx
- 操作系统文件管理实验报告要点.doc
- 2023年转专业面试物理到计算机.docx
- 软件质量保证试题答案(20211112235521).pdf
- 神经网络-(2)神经元与网络结构.ppt
- 《自动化仪表概述》PPT课件.pdf
- 信息系统项目管理实验.doc
- 基于PLC车辆出入库管理.doc
- 基于单片机的门禁系统.docx



- 1
- 2
前往页